Pair Trading with Federal National and L Brands
The main advantage of trading using opposite Federal National and L Brands positions is that it hedges away some unsystematic risk. Because of two separate transactions, even if Federal National position performs unexpectedly, L Brands can make up some of the losses. Pair trading also minimizes risk from directional movements in the market.
